How Safe Is Ozone Chain (OZO) Coin?
Ozone Chain (OZO) is a blockchain platform designed to provide a secure and efficient environment for developing and deploying decentralized applications. Its native cryptocurrency, OZO, plays a crucial role in securing the network and facilitating transactions. Here's an in-depth analysis of the security features and measures implemented by Ozone Chain to ensure the safety of OZO coins:
1. Proof-of-Stake Consensus Mechanism
Ozone Chain utilizes a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) consensus mechanism to secure its network. In a PoS system, validators are selected based on the number of OZO coins they hold, incentivizing them to act honestly and maintain the integrity of the blockchain.
- Benefits of PoS:
- Enhanced security: Validators have a vested interest in keeping the network secure, as their holdings are at stake.
- Energy efficiency: PoS consumes significantly less energy than Proof-of-Work (PoW) systems, reducing the environmental impact.
- Scalability: PoS allows for faster transaction processing and network scalability.
2. Multi-Layer Security Architecture
Ozone Chain employs a multi-layer security architecture to protect OZO coins and the network from various threats. This architecture consists of multiple layers of defense, each focusing on a specific aspect of security:
- Application Layer: This layer protects against malicious smart contracts and vulnerabilities in decentralized applications (dApps).
- Protocol Layer: The protocol layer safeguards the underlying blockchain infrastructure, ensuring the integrity of the network and transaction data.
- Infrastructure Layer: This layer secures the hardware and software components that support the Ozone Chain network, preventing unauthorized access and attacks.
3. Decentralized Network Structure
Ozone Chain operates as a decentralized network, meaning it is not controlled by a single entity. Instead, the network is maintained by a distributed network of nodes, each running a copy of the blockchain.
- Benefits of Decentralization:
- Enhanced security: Decentralization makes it more difficult for attackers to compromise the network, as there is no single point of failure.
- Increased resilience: The distributed nature of the network ensures that it remains operational even if some nodes are compromised or taken offline.
- Improved transparency: All transactions and activities on the Ozone Chain are transparent and visible to everyone on the network.
4. Smart Contract Security Features
Smart contracts play a vital role in the functionality of Ozone Chain and its dApps. To ensure their security, Ozone Chain has implemented several features:
- Formal Verification: Ozone Chain utilizes formal verification techniques to analyze and validate smart contracts, reducing the risk of vulnerabilities and ensuring their correctness.
- Gas Limit: The gas limit mechanism controls the amount of computational resources that can be expended by a smart contract, preventing malicious contracts from consuming excessive resources and potentially disrupting the network.
- Account Abstraction: Ozone Chain introduces account abstraction, allowing users to create new accounts without directly interacting with smart contracts, enhancing security and reducing the risk of phishing attacks.
5. Ongoing Security Audits and Updates
Ozone Chain regularly undergoes independent security audits to identify and address potential vulnerabilities. These audits are performed by reputable third-party security firms to ensure the platform's integrity and the safety of OZO coins.
- Importance of Security Audits:
- Continuous security reviews help identify vulnerabilities and weaknesses, preventing malicious actors from exploiting them.
- Regular updates patch identified vulnerabilities, ensuring the ongoing security of the network and OZO coins.
6. Secure Storage and Custody Options
Ozone Chain provides various options for secure storage and custody of OZO coins:
- Non-Custodial Wallets: Users can store OZO coins in non-custodial wallets, where they retain full control over their private keys and assets.
- Hardware Wallets: Hardware wallets offer an offline and secure method for storing OZO coins, protecting them from online threats and unauthorized access.
- Institutional-Grade Custodians: Ozone Chain partners with regulated and reputable custodians to provide secure storage solutions for large amounts of OZO coins, catering to the needs of institutional investors.
7. Community Involvement and Transparency
The Ozone Chain community plays a crucial role in ensuring the safety of OZO coins and the network.
- Community Reporting: The community is encouraged to report any suspicious activities or vulnerabilities to the Ozone Chain team, promoting a proactive approach to security.
- Network Monitoring: Community members can participate in monitoring the network for potential threats and irregularities, contributing to the overall security of the ecosystem.
- Open-Source Code: The Ozone Chain codebase is open-source, allowing independent developers and security researchers to review and contribute to its ongoing development and improvement.
8. Regulatory Compliance and Legal Protections
Ozone Chain actively works to comply with relevant regulations and legal frameworks to ensure the safety and legitimacy of OZO coins:
- Anti-Money Laundering (AML) and Know-Your-Customer (KYC) Measures: Ozone Chain implements AML/KYC procedures to prevent the use of its platform for illicit activities and protect users from financial crimes.
- Collaboration with Law Enforcement: Ozone Chain cooperates with law enforcement agencies to investigate and prosecute malicious actors attempting to compromise the network or engage in fraudulent activities involving OZO coins.
- Legal Protection: The Ozone Chain team has taken legal steps to protect the project and its users, including obtaining necessary licenses and registrations where required.
